## Executive Snapshot
**What it is:** Den Hete Saté is a branded food ordering app for takeaway, allowing local customers to schedule orders and use coupons on iOS and Android.
**Why users hire it:** The app serves the job of queue-avoidance for loyal customers, allowing them to secure meals without the commission costs of third-party delivery aggregators.

## App DNA (Features & Intent)
- **[Standard] Order Scheduling:** Allows users to place takeaway orders for a future date or time
- **[Standard] Order History & Favorites:** Enables one-tap reordering of past items or saved preferences
- **[Standard] Coupon Codes:** Provides access to discounts and promotional extras via input codes

### Den Hete Saté vs Uber Eats: Food & Groceries — Head to Head
- **[Uber Eats: Food & Groceries](https://marlvel.ai/apps/uber-eats-food-groceries)** by Uber Technologies, Inc.: Uber Eats competes directly for the same food-ordering audience by providing a massive, multi-category marketplace that captures the convenience-seeking user base Den Hete Saté targets.
  - **Key differences:**
    - Offers a massive multi-category marketplace including groceries, convenience stores, and alcohol delivery options.
    - Leverages a global logistics network for real-time order tracking and highly predictable delivery ETAs.
    - Provides a subscription-based loyalty program, Uber One, which incentivizes recurring usage through reduced delivery fees.
  - **Where Den Hete Saté wins:**
    - ✅ Focuses exclusively on a specialized menu, potentially offering higher quality control for specific local favorites.
    - ✅ Avoids the high commission fees charged by third-party aggregators, allowing for better pricing or margins.
  - **Where Uber Eats: Food & Groceries wins:**
    - ❌ Massive network effect and brand recognition drive significantly higher user acquisition and retention rates.
    - ❌ Advanced algorithmic dispatch and real-time tracking provide a superior, frictionless post-order experience.
  - **Verdict:** Den Hete Saté cannot compete on scale; it must double down on local brand loyalty and personalized service to retain its core customer base.
